1969 AMC AMX 390 Tach - Auto - All Stock


Tach turns on mmm every 5th or 6th trip

I pulled the dash off, ran a new wiring harness around the window to test. Before I pulled all the wires out of the bay....no tach

the car runs....if I disconnect the old wires or the new wires...engine dies.

either set of wires...no tach...

Butttttt the tach does work ? just once every 3 months ?

IS there a ground I am missing  ?  

ALL GUAGES WORK BESIDES THIS

Yes. Sounds like a ground issue. The '69 tach built into the cluster will allow one to drive the car even if the tach is burned out. The '68 Tach will not. Check your grounds for the cluster.

After checking the grounds, with the engine running, put your hand up and give the main instrument harness connector a wiggle and see if anything changes.
Don't have the rally cluster but mine did have a board pin loose in the cluster. Intermittent on off gas and temperature gauge from the same power supply. Had to take the board out and solder the pin to the board to ensure good electrical connection - did all of them since I was in there.

You are correct, the AMX tach does not use a ground. It's inline with the power feeding the ignition coil. I'd think if there was an intermittent connection you'd have a misfiring engine.
